Output d21f28d649406072398c6e8eb2a2d8c624cfec61daeb026b60a8edd76027288a:0

value
479075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023efd6eb921129c8bb0f76dac44cccb79109b10 OP_EQUAL
address
31ttjYhQMjTYLRxDszFVmB4P8XFChGwYLB
transaction
d21f28d649406072398c6e8eb2a2d8c624cfec61daeb026b60a8edd76027288a
spent
true